Aims

The module focuses on Investigating and exploring the application of researched informed diagnostic and intervention design models, frameworks and approaches in order to enhance organisation effectiveness.

Learning Outcomes

1.
Evaluate the appropriateness and application of diagnostic models, frameworks and approaches when analysing complex problems.
2.
Apply insights from systems thinking, multi-level perspectives and social practice theories to frame complex problems
3.
Critically evaluate and apply theory-driven approaches to the development of complex interventions on individual, group and organisational level.
4.
Demonstrate expert judgement in formulating responses to complex social, cultural and ethical issues in a range of organisational contexts;
5.
Critical reflect on the strengths and weaknesses of proposed interventions and adapt intervention if required.

Module Content

Outline Syllabus:Levels of diagnosis– intrapersonal, interpersonal, group, inter-group, system, inter-system Diagnostic instruments Psychometric tests Action research and learning Appreciative enquiry Multicultural OD Design theories and approaches OD tools and practices
